Jawaharlal Nehru New College of Engineering, Shimoga offers admissions to three various levels of programmes, which include undergraduate, postgraduate and doctoral levels under different specialisations. JNNCE admissions under different specialisations such as management and business administration, engineering and architecture, and others.
Jawaharlal Nehru New College of Engineering Shimoga admissions are granted to candidates who meet the eligibility criteria. For JNNCE admissions, the entrance exams accepted by the institute are COMEDK UGET, KCET for UG B. Tech courses. Karnataka PGCET , GATE for JNNCE PG courses that are M. Tech, M. Sc, MCA and MBA degree courses, and lastly, ULTRA test is conducted for JNNCE doctoral courses Ph. D programmes.
Selected candidates may verify their documents and pay the JNNCE course fee. Jawaharlal Nehru New College of Engineering UG Courses, Seat Intake and Eligibility Criteria Course Seat Intake Eligibility Criteria BE 990 Class 10+2 with 45% marks from a recognised board + COMEDK UGET /KCET. JNNCE Shimoga BE Admission Process Candidates must meet the eligibility criteria of the college. Candidates must appear for the COMEDK UGET/ KCET entrance exam and obtain a decent rank.
JNNCE cutoffs will be released after the results of the entrance exams are announced. Candidates who have acquired the required cutoff percentile may proceed with the counselling round of the respective entrance test. Candidates must select Jawaharlal Nehru New College of Engineering as their preferred college during the choice filling.
Jawaharlal Nehru New College of Engineering admissions are done based on the scores obtained in the entrance exam and past academic performance. Candidates have to verify their documents at the campus and pay the JNNCE course fees to confirm their allotted seats.
